Story summary
- Food and Drug Administration (FDA) Commissioner Marty Makary faces scrutiny from Trump officials amid agency turmoil, linked to the pending retirement of Dr. Richard Pazdur.
- Pazdur's departure raises concerns about the FDA's drug review process.
- White House officials express confidence in Makary's leadership despite FDA upheaval.
- Pazdur has warned about political interference in drug reviews and safety standards.
- Some Trump allies downplay Pazdur's exit as typical for a career official.
